Don Henley Live Inside Job

Don Henley Live  Inside JobGrammy Award winner Don Henley helped define The '70s have a member of The Successful fabulously rock band The Eagles Before Launching impressive solo career year. On May 25, 2000, he Returned to His Roots for Texas A Remarkable concert, recorded year Before Enthusiastic audience at Fair Park Music Hall in Dallas. This rock legend's live performance captures All the passion, satire and Originality That Fans Around the World In His treasure MOST Influential music. Songs: Dirty Laundry, Sunset Grill, Workin 'It, Takin' You Home, The Boys of Summer, Lilah, Everything is Different Now, The End of the Innocence, All She Wants To Do Is Dance, New York Minute, Talking to the Moon, They're Not Here They're Not Coming, The Heart of the Matter, Desperado, The Long Run, My Thanksgiving, Hotel California.

Don Henley is one of those artists people either love or hate:he strikes one as either wise and insightful or smug and arrogant.In "Live Inside Job," Henley reminds us that whatever the viewer's opinion of him, he's written an impressive list of songs that spans three decades.The concert (taken in part from A&E's "Live By Request" broadcast) leans heavily on songs from "Inside Job," although there is a good sampling from all of Henley's solo albums.Eagles fans who buy the DVD may be disappointed by the sparsity of Eagles songs, although Henley closes with a ska/reggae version of "Hotel California" that is worth the the price of the DVD alone.The DVD has a few drawbacks:at times, the sound mix is bad (Henley's vocals on "Taking You Home" are almost inaudible at first) and there are virtually no extras (a couple videos would have been a nice touch).Those are minor disadvantages, though, and the concert itself is an enjoyable reminder of how blue-eyed soulful a singer Henley still is.This is a nice addition to anyone's collection of music DVD's.

You all know Henley so I'll spare the career retrospective. This DVD was taped May 25, 2000 at Fair Park Music Hall in Dallas. From the opener of Dirty Laundry through the entire set and closing with Hotel California, this is a great show by a fantastic song writer. Don's voice sounds great on this night and his back-up band is very sharp. Not a lot of talk between songs, but one great tune after another. The other songs include Sunset Grill, Workin' It, Taking You Home, The Boys of Summer, Lilah, Everything is Different Now, The End of the Innocence, All She Wants to Do is Dance, New York Minute, Talking to the Moon, They're Not Here (They're Not Coming), The Heart of the Matter, Desperado, The Long Run, and My Thanksgiving.

That covers the show, now on to the DVD features... well, there really aren't any. The sound quality is excellent and the production is flawless, but no multiple camera angles, no extras, no videos, just a short intro then on to the show. I'm not complaining as the show is fantastic, but if you like whistles and bells look elsewhere. If you love Henley, the Eagles or just great music then you'll still love it.
